Intriguing and well-preserved images and sculptures from a former empire, including the important Crystal Buddha, decorate the oldest temple in the city.

Art in Paradise, Chiang Mai National Museum, and Lanna Architecture Center fe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Explore landmarks like Wat Chiang Man, Tha Phae Gate, and Wat Phra Singh. Spend some time wandering around Elephant Nature Park, Buak Haad Park, and Suan Buak Haad Park.
